Why Annual Chimney Inspections Are Important

The National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) recommends yearly inspections for good reason. Regular use leads to wear and tear and also creosote buildup inside the chimney. Inspections and cleanings help manage this accumulation before it becomes dangerous. They can also identify cracks in flue liners, assess masonry deterioration, and detect water intrusion or structural concerns. Catching these small issues early prevents larger, more expensive repairs later. It also protects the efficiency of your fireplace and extends the life of your chimney system.

Signs You May Need a Chimney Cleaning

If it has been a year or more since your last cleaning, there are a few clear signs to watch for. You may notice increased soot in and around the firebox. Strong, smoky odors are often the most obvious indicator, especially if they become more noticeable on damp or rainy days. If smoke enters the living space or the draft seems weaker than usual, that is another sign your chimney needs attention. Addressing these warning signs early helps prevent bigger problems down the line.

Protecting Your Home and Family

Many chimney fires start due to excessive creosote buildup. It is a preventable issue when handled with routine professional maintenance. Carbon monoxide is also a concern when flues are blocked or damaged, as harmful fumes can back up into the home.

Regular inspections reduce both fire hazards and ventilation risks, thereby supporting a safer, healthier living environment. Preventative maintenance offers peace of mind during heavy-use months and allows you to enjoy your fireplace with confidence.
